Charity Race Night

A full house in the Trust Hall on 28th November enjoyed a Race Night organised and run entirely by volunteers from William Hill Ltd.  There were eight sponsored races, with the eight horses in each race also sponsored.  Together with profit from the Tote and the bar, the evening raised an excellent £2,337.  To the delight of the Trust and Southdown Play Area Group, William Hill Ltd later donated £500 each to both Charities under their matched funding scheme.

The photograph shows Barbara Berki, the William Hill representative, handing over the cheque to the Town Mayor and the Chairman of the Trust.
